Transaction e596e322090652c3ff1d5277897763805f20870e37ef56e2255dc6ff4065f009
1 Input
1 Output
-
e596e322090652c3ff1d5277897763805f20870e37ef56e2255dc6ff4065f009:0
- value
- 60640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58240367c84150aae16914f068e439f932c754fc OP_EQUAL
- address
- 39j4Xfz3FwjkACYYJmw956bagrogXmRpBG